To remove a specific payment from an already processed payment file, you can follow these steps: 1. Navigate to the payment record that you want to remove. You can do this by going to the 'Transactions' tab, then 'Pay Bills', and then 'Payment List'. 2. Once you've found the payment record, click on 'Edit'. 3. In the 'Payment' tab, click on 'Delete'. This will remove the payment record from the system. 4. After deleting the payment record, you need to rerun the Payment File Administration for that batch. To do this, go to the 'Transactions' tab, then 'Management', and then 'Payment File Administration'. 5. Find the batch that included the deleted payment and click on 'Reprocess'. This will regenerate the payment file without the deleted payment. Please note that this process will only work if the payment file has not been finalized and sent to the bank.
